内容简介:
An epic history of a doomed civilization and a lost
empire.
The devastating struggle to the death between the
Carthaginians and the Romans was one of the defining dramas of the
ancient world. In an epic series of land and sea battles, both
sides came close to victory before the Carthaginians finally
succumbed and their capital city, history, and culture were almost
utterly erased.
Drawing on a wealth of new archaeological research, Richard Miles
vividly brings to life this lost empire-from its origins among the
Phoenician settlements of Lebanon to its apotheosis as the greatest
seapower in the Mediterranean. And at the heart of the history of
Carthage lies the extraordinary figure of Hannibal-the scourge of
Rome and one of the greatest military leaders, but a man who also
unwittingly led his people to catastrophe.
The first full-scale history of Carthage in decades, Carthage
Must Be Destroyed reintroduces modern readers to the
larger-than-life historical players and the ancient glory of this
almost forgotten civilization.

作者介绍:
Richard Miles teaches ancient history at the
University of Sydney and is a Fellow-Commoner of Trinity Hall,
University of Cambridge. He has written widely on Punic, Roman, and
Vandal North Africa and has directed archaeological excavations in
Carthage and Rome. He lives in Sydney, Australia.

原文赏析:
早先卡普亚所遭受的命运一一人民沦为奴隶、法定地位被取消、出海口被剥夺一一只是一场在地中海地区到处上演的历史大戏的带妆彩排罢了。迦太基与科林斯的灭亡,如今不仅成了两座血淋淋的纪念碑,记载着反抗罗马的代价,同时它也令人信服地朗声预言:罗马成为一个世界强权的时机已然成熟。
